FX eTrading Java Back-End Engineer, Vice President
FX eTrading Java Back-End Engineer, Vice President

FX eTrading Java Back-End Engineer, Vice President

Bolton Full-Time 43200 - 72000 ÂŁ / year (est.) No home office possible
B

At a Glance

  • Tasks: Develop low latency connectivity for FX trading applications and troubleshoot performance issues.
  • Company: Join BNY, a leading global financial services firm impacting 20% of the world's investable assets.
  • Benefits: Enjoy competitive pay, flexible resources, generous leave, and paid volunteer time.
  • Why this job: Be part of an innovative team in a supportive culture that values diversity and inclusion.
  • Qualifications: Strong Java skills, knowledge of TCP/UDP and financial messaging protocols required.
  • Other info: This role is hybrid, based in Manchester, with opportunities for growth and collaboration.

The predicted salary is between 43200 - 72000 ÂŁ per year.

At BNY, our culture empowers you to grow and succeed. As a leading global financial services company at the center of the world’s financial system we touch nearly 20% of the world’s investible assets. Every day around the globe, our 50,000+ employees bring the power of their perspective to the table to create solutions with our clients that benefit businesses, communities and people everywhere.

We continue to be a leader in the industry, awarded as a top home for innovators and for creating an inclusive workplace. Through our unique ideas and talents, together we help make money work for the world. This is what #LifeAtBNY is all about.

We’re seeking a future team member for the role of FX eTrading Java Back-End Engineer, Vice President to join our FX eTrading Engineering team. This role is located in Manchester – HYBRID.

In this role, you’ll make an impact in the following ways:

  • Building low latency connectivity to new markets
  • Hands on technical development role on a critical trading application
  • Requirements capture, analysis and design on the eTrading platform
  • Testing and UA coordination
  • Liaison with the global business, support and development teams
  • Troubleshoot and optimization on performance and scalability issues
  • Third line support of the platform during trading hours
  • Close interaction with the business product manager and other internal business users covering FX trading

To be successful in this role, we’re seeking the following:

  • Very strong core Java - including threading, sockets/networks
  • Well versed in TCP/UDP protocols
  • Knowledge of financial messaging protocols especially FIX
  • Solid SDLC knowledge and use of build, testing, deploy, code analysis tools
  • Nice to have: KDB, Middleware’s such as Tibco RV, Solace
  • Strong interpersonal and articulation skills (spoken and written)
  • Ability to partner with non-technical and technical peers; to work effectively with remote colleagues, and to participate in technical discussions

At BNY, our culture speaks for itself. Here’s a few of our awards:

  • America’s Most Innovative Companies, Fortune, 2024
  • World’s Most Admired Companies, Fortune 2024
  • Human Rights Campaign Foundation, Corporate Equality Index, 100% score
  • Best Places to Work for Disability Inclusion, Disability: IN – 100% score
  • “Most Just Companies”, Just Capital and CNBC, 2024
  • Dow Jones Sustainability Indices, Top performing company for Sustainability, 2024
  • Bloomberg’s Gender Equality Index (GEI), 2023

Our Benefits and Rewards: BNY offers highly competitive compensation, benefits, and wellbeing programs rooted in a strong culture of excellence and our pay-for-performance philosophy. We provide access to flexible global resources and tools for your life’s journey. Focus on your health, foster your personal resilience, and reach your financial goals as a valued member of our team, along with generous paid leaves, including paid volunteer time, that can support you and your family through moments that matter.

BNY is an Equal Employment Opportunity/Affirmative Action Employer - Underrepresented racial and ethnic groups/Females/Individuals with Disabilities/Protected Veterans.

FX eTrading Java Back-End Engineer, Vice President employer: BNY

At BNY, we pride ourselves on fostering a culture that empowers our employees to thrive and innovate. Located in Manchester, our hybrid work environment offers a unique blend of flexibility and collaboration, allowing you to engage with a diverse team while contributing to impactful financial solutions. With competitive compensation, comprehensive benefits, and a commitment to inclusivity and employee growth, BNY is an exceptional place for those seeking meaningful and rewarding careers in the financial services sector.
B

Contact Detail:

BNY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land FX eTrading Java Back-End Engineer, Vice President

✨Tip Number 1

Familiarise yourself with the specific technologies mentioned in the job description, such as core Java, TCP/UDP protocols, and financial messaging protocols like FIX. Being able to discuss these topics confidently during your interview will demonstrate your technical expertise and alignment with the role.

✨Tip Number 2

Network with current or former employees of BNY, especially those in the FX eTrading Engineering team. Engaging in conversations about their experiences can provide you with valuable insights into the company culture and expectations, which you can leverage during your application process.

✨Tip Number 3

Prepare to showcase your problem-solving skills by discussing past experiences where you optimised performance or resolved complex issues in a trading environment. This will highlight your ability to handle the responsibilities outlined in the job description.

✨Tip Number 4

Demonstrate your interpersonal skills by preparing examples of how you've successfully collaborated with both technical and non-technical teams. This is crucial for the role, as it involves liaising with various stakeholders within the business.

We think you need these skills to ace FX eTrading Java Back-End Engineer, Vice President

Core Java
Threading
Sockets/Networks
TCP/UDP Protocols
Financial Messaging Protocols (especially FIX)
Software Development Life Cycle (SDLC)
Build Tools
Testing Tools
Deployment Tools
Code Analysis Tools
KDB (nice to have)
Tibco RV (nice to have)
Solace (nice to have)
Interpersonal Skills
Articulation Skills (spoken and written)
Collaboration with Technical and Non-Technical Peers
Remote Team Collaboration
Technical Discussion Participation
Troubleshooting Skills
Performance Optimization
Scalability Issues Management

Some tips for your application 🫡

Understand the Role: Before applying, make sure you fully understand the responsibilities and requirements of the FX eTrading Java Back-End Engineer position. Tailor your application to highlight relevant experience in core Java, financial messaging protocols, and any other specific skills mentioned in the job description.

Craft a Tailored CV: Your CV should reflect your technical expertise and experience in low latency connectivity, troubleshooting, and performance optimisation. Use keywords from the job description to ensure your CV aligns with what BNY is looking for.

Write a Compelling Cover Letter: In your cover letter, express your enthusiasm for the role and the company culture at BNY. Highlight your interpersonal skills and ability to work with both technical and non-technical teams, as these are crucial for the position.

Proofread Your Application: Before submitting, carefully proofread your CV and cover letter for any spelling or grammatical errors. A polished application reflects your attention to detail and professionalism, which are important in the financial services industry.

How to prepare for a job interview at BNY

✨Showcase Your Java Expertise

Make sure to highlight your strong core Java skills during the interview. Be prepared to discuss threading, sockets, and networking in detail, as these are crucial for the role.

✨Understand Financial Messaging Protocols

Familiarise yourself with financial messaging protocols, especially FIX. Being able to explain how these protocols work and their importance in eTrading will set you apart from other candidates.

✨Demonstrate Problem-Solving Skills

Prepare to discuss past experiences where you've troubleshot performance and scalability issues. Use specific examples to illustrate your analytical thinking and problem-solving abilities.

✨Communicate Effectively

Since the role requires liaising with both technical and non-technical teams, practice articulating complex technical concepts in a simple manner. Strong interpersonal skills will be key to your success.

FX eTrading Java Back-End Engineer, Vice President
BNY
B
  • FX eTrading Java Back-End Engineer, Vice President

    Bolton
    Full-Time
    43200 - 72000 ÂŁ / year (est.)

    Application deadline: 2027-06-26

  • B

    BNY

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>